Bucktober Wins Western Fair Preferred In Lifetime Best

Bucktober accomplished three notable achievements on Tuesday (April 18) winning the $13,000 Preferred Trot at The Raceway at the Western Fair District in a new lifetime mark and posting a ninth seasonal win, the most on Canadian soil in 2023.

Trainer Tyler Borth was once again in the bike of Bucktober in the top class, seeking redemption after a fourth-place finish in last week's (April 11) feature halted an eight-race win streak of the duo. Borth eased the gelding out of post three, getting away fourth as Power And Grace (Brett MacDonald) led the field to an opening quarter in :28. As they reached the half in :58.2, Bucktober was still gapped out, leaving him 5-1/2 lengths off of the leader. Eyes Of Justice (Travis Henry) was out on the move from third just before the three-quarters in 1:27.3 and Bucktober hit the gas to follow his lead. Around the final turn, Bucktober moved three-wide and sprinted in the stretch to win by 1-1/2 lengths in 1:58.2, a new career mark. Power And Grace finished second and Sicario (Jason Ryan) was third. Bucktober paid $9.90 to win.

Bucktober (Flanagan Memory - Armbro Equinox) is a winner of 16 races in 32 career starts and the four-year-old gelding has been out of the money on only three occasions in those starts. Tyler Borth, Bill Borth and Karen Sparling co-own the career earner of more than $80,000. In addition to his nine seasonal wins, Bucktober has had a second and two fourths to complete his 12 races of 2023 thus far.
